SFC 修复失败

SFC /Scannow

结果为: 发现损坏文件,但不能修复.


DISM.exe /Online /Cleanup-image /Scanhealth,按回车键,

DISM.exe /Online /Cleanup-image /Restorehealth,按回车键。

完成后请重启电脑。


<think>嗯,用户遇到了Windows系统SFC修复失败的问题,这确实是个棘手的系统故障。从用户提问的英文句式看,可能是非中文母语者,但系统要求用中文回复,需要确保术语准确且通俗易懂。 用户之前应该已经尝试过sfc /scannow命令但失败了,现在处于比较焦虑的状态。深层需求其实是希望在不重装系统的前提下修复关键文件。考虑到系统文件损坏可能影响系统稳定性,需要给出安全有效的解决方案。 查阅资料时注意到两个关键点:一是SFC依赖组件存储(CBS)的完整性[^1],二是恶意软件或磁盘错误可能导致修复失败[^2]。这提示解决方案需要分层次推进:先确保修复环境正常,再处理文件损坏本身。 首先想到的排查方向是磁盘错误和权限问题,因为这是最常见的失败原因。chkdsk和DISM工具应该作为第一步推荐,它们能解决80%的SFC失败案例。特别要强调以管理员身份运行命令,很多用户会忽略这个细节。 对于顽固性损坏,需要更深入的解决方案。安全模式能排除第三方干扰,而离线部署则绕过系统运行时锁定问题。考虑到用户可能不是技术专家,离线操作要给出明确路径指引,比如用winre启动环境的步骤。 最后必须包含应急方案。当所有修复无效时,系统还原点是最佳选择,这比直接建议重装系统更友好。要提醒用户确认还原点时效性,避免找回更早的问题状态。 生成的相关问题覆盖了用户可能需要的延伸知识:日志分析是进阶排错的关键,替代工具满足不同场景需求,而根本原因分析能帮助预防问题复发。特别是恶意软件扫描这点,结合引用[2]的高危漏洞警告,有必要单独强调。</think>遇到SFC扫描失败时,可按照以下步骤逐步解决: --- ### **第一步:运行磁盘检查** 磁盘错误会导致SFC失败,先修复文件系统: 1. 以**管理员身份**打开命令提示符 2. 输入命令: ```cmd chkdsk C: /f /r ``` (按`Y`同意重启后扫描) 3. 重启电脑完成扫描 --- ### **第二步:修复组件存储** SFC依赖系统组件存储库,损坏时需先修复: ```cmd DISM /Online /Cleanup-Image /RestoreHealth ``` > 该过程需联网下载健康文件,耗时约10-20分钟 --- ### **第三步:在安全模式重试SFC** 关闭第三方程序干扰: 1. Win+R输入`msconfig` → 引导 → 勾选**安全启动** 2. 重启进入安全模式 3. 再次运行: ```cmd sfc /scannow ``` --- ### **第四步:离线修复系统文件** 若仍失败,需从安装介质修复: 1. 挂载Windows ISO或插入安装U盘 2. 管理员命令提示符执行: ```cmd DISM /Online /Cleanup-Image /RestoreHealth /Source:wim:X:\sources\install.wim:1 ``` (将`X:`替换为实际光驱盘符) --- ### **第五步:手动替换损坏文件** 1. 在SFC日志中定位损坏文件: ```cmd findstr /c:"[SR]" %windir%\Logs\CBS\CBS.log >"%userprofile%\Desktop\sfcdetails.txt" ``` 2. 从健康电脑复制同名文件到故障机对应路径 3. 重启后重试SFC --- ### **终极方案:系统还原** 若所有方法无效,使用系统还原点: 1. 搜索`创建还原点` → 系统保护 → **系统还原** 2. 选择故障前的健康还原点 > ⚠️ 注意:若系统文件被恶意软件篡改,需先运行`mrt`进行全盘扫描[^2] --- ###
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值